Pittsburgh Police Investigate Shooting in Strip District

PITTSBURGH, PA – Police are investigating a shooting that occurred Friday morning in the 2000 block of Penn Avenue in the Strip District.

Police reported two males arrived at a hospital emergency room with gunshot wounds around 12:45 a.m. Both victims, one shot in the foot and the other in the arm and leg, are in stable condition.

Officers located a crime scene but have not made any arrests at this time.

Anyone with information about the incident is encouraged to call Violent Crime Unit detectives at (412) 323-7161.
